Well, Marcus Tooze, sounds like you have a job on your hands. My first
restoration was a Spit 1500, but it was fun and quite easy. Yes, minus 
the steering rack, fluid lines and electrics (and the so easy to forget
engine ground) the body comes off and on easily with 12 bolts. And yes
again the body is VERY floppy off the backbone. Almost a Chapman creation
in its strength mius the chassis !

The 1500 engine is Triumph stuff alright, but was put into Midgets,with 
much protest from MG fans, late in the game when BMC, or whatever they 
were calling themselves that week, tried to get some commonality in
their parts (HA HA !) It's a good angine, but am oil coiler is a good
idea, and if your going to really drive it don't rev too high or the
 number 3 piston might exit the block !
